Lower limb lymphedema treated with lymphatico-venous anastomosis based on pre- and intraoperative icg lymphography and non-contact vein visualization: A case report.

Abstract 

Lymphatico-venous anastomosis (LVA) is used to resolve lymph retention in lymphedema. However, the postoperative outcome of lower limb lymphedema is poorer than that for upper limb lymphedema, because of the location lower than the heart level. Improvement of the therapeutic outcome requires application of as many anastomoses as possible in a limited operation time, particularly since there is a positive correlation between the number of anastomoses and the therapeutic effect of LVA. In this case, we described a method to increase the efficiency of lymphatico-venous anastomosis for bilateral severe lower limb lymphedema through efficient identification of lymph vessels and veins suitable for anastomosis using indocyanine green (ICG) contrast imaging and AccuVein, a noncontact vein visualization system, respectively. Ten LVAs were succeeded at seven incisions, and the operation time was 3 hours and 5 minutes. Accuvein can be used for identification of subcutaneous venules with a diameter of about 0.5-1.0 mm. We used this approach in surgery for a case of bilateral lower limb lymphedema, with a resultant improvement in the surgical outcome.

Is selective lymphadenectomy more cost-effective than routine lymphadenectomy in patients with endometrial cancer?

Abstract


OBJECTIVE:

The objective of this study is to determine the cost-effectiveness of two strategies in women undergoing surgery for newly diagnosed endometrial cancer.

METHODS:

A decision analysis model compared two surgical strategies: 1) routine lymphadenectomy independent of intraoperative risk factors or 2) selective lymphadenectomy for women with high or intermediate risk tumors based on intraoperative assessment including tumor grade, depth of invasion, and tumor size. Published data were used to estimate the outcomes of stage, adjuvant therapy, and recurrence. Costs of surgery, radiation, and chemotherapy were estimated using Medicare Current Procedural Technology codes and Physician Fee Schedule. Cost-effectiveness ratios were estimated for each strategy. Sensitivity analyses were performed including an estimate for lymphedema (10%) for patients that underwent a lymphadenectomy.

RESULTS:

For 40,000 women diagnosed annually with endometrial cancer in the United States, the annual cost of selective lymphadenectomy is $1.14billion compared to $1.02billion for routine lymphadenectomy. The selective lymphadenectomy strategy was $123.3million more expensive. Five-year progression-free survival was 85.9% with routine compared to 79.3% with selective. Treatment cost $6349 more per survivor in the selective strategy compared to routine strategy ($36,078 vs. $29,729). These results held up under a variety of sensitivity analyses including costs due to lymphedema which were higher in the routine lymphadenectomy strategy compared to the selective lymphadenectomy strategy ($10million vs. $7.75million).

CONCLUSIONS:

A strategy of selective lymphadenectomy based on intraoperative risk factors for patients with endometrial cancer was less effective and more costly than routine lymphadenectomy even when the impact of lymphedema was considered.

Complications of lymphadenectomy for gynecologic cancer.

Abstract


INTRODUCTION: 

Symptomatic postoperative lymphocysts (SPOLs) and lower-limb lymphedema (LLL) are probably underestimated complications of lymphadenectomy for gynecologic malignancies. Here, our objective was to evaluate the incidence and risk factors of SPOLs and LLL after pelvic and/or aortocaval lymphadenectomy for gynecologic malignancies.

METHODS: Single-center retrospective study of consecutive patients who underwent pelvic and/or aortocaval lymphadenectomy for ovarian cancer, endometrial cancer, or cervical cancer between January 2007 and November 2008. The incidences of SPOL and LLL were computed with their 95% confidence intervals (95%CIs). Multivariate logistic regression was performed to identify independent risk factors for SPOL and LLL.

RESULTS: 
We identified 88 patients including 36 with ovarian cancer, 35 with endometrial cancer, and 17 with cervical cancer. The overall incidence of SPOL was 34.5% (95%CI, 25-45) and that of LLL was 11.4% (95% confidence interval [95%CI], 5-18). Endometrial cancer was independently associated with a lower risk of SPOL (adjusted odds ratio [aOR], 0.09; 95%CI, 0.02-0.44) and one or more positive pelvic nodes with a higher risk of SPOL (aOR, 4.4; 95%CI, 1.2-16.3). Multivariate logistic regression failed to identify factors significantly associated with LLL.

CONCLUSION:

Complications of lymphadenectomy for gynecologic malignancies are common. This finding supports a more restrictive use of lymphadenectomy or the use of less invasive techniques such as sentinel node biopsy.

The earliest finding of indocyanine green lymphography in asymptomatic limbs of lower extremity lymphedema patients secondary to cancer treatment: the modified dermal backflow stage and concept of subclinical lymphedema.

ABSTRACT

Early diagnosis and treatment are as important for management of secondary lymphedema following cancer treatment as in primary cancer treatment. Indocyanine green lymphography is the modality of choice for routine follow-up evaluation of patients at high risk of developing lymphedema after cancer therapy.

Fifty-six limbs of 28 so-called unilateral secondary lower extremity lymphedema patients who underwent indocyanine green lymphography were compared with dermal backflow patterns of indocyanine green lymphography on 28 asymptomatic limbs and assessed using leg dermal backflow stage.

Of 28 asymptomatic limbs of secondary lower extremity lymphedema patients, the dermal backflow patterns were detected in 19 limbs but were absent in nine limbs. Significant differences were seen between asymptomatic limbs with dermal backflow patterns (n=19) and limbs without them (n=9): age, 51 versus 34, body weight 75 kg versus 34kg, body mass index 23 versus 19, leg dermal bacflow stage of symptomatice limb 3 versus 2.

The splash pattern is the earliest finding on indocyanine green lymphography of asymptomatic limbs of secondary lower extremity lymphedema patients. The leg dermal backflow stage allows early diagnosis of secondary lower extremity lymphedema even in a subclinical stage. The concept of subclinical lymphedema could play an important role in early diagnosis and prevention of lymphedema after cancer treatment.

Lower extremity lymphedema index: a simple method for severity evaluation of lower extremity lymphedema.

ABSTRACT

Measurement of the circumference is the most commonly used method for evaluating extremity lymphedema. However, comparison between different patients is difficult with this measurement. To resolve this problem, we have formulated a new index, lower extremity lymphedema (LEL) index, which can be easily obtained from measurements of the body. We evaluated correlation between lower LEL index and clinical stage in patients with LEL. The LEL indices were significantly correlated with clinical stages and could be used as a severity scale. The LEL index makes objective assessment of the severity of lymphedema through a numerical rating, regardless of the body type. This numerical rating makes the index useful for evaluation of lymphedema severities between different cases.

A case in which sarcoma was diagnosed two years after stent placement to treat right iliac vein stenosis that accompanied severe unilateral leg edema.

Abstract


A 70-year-old man complained of right leg swelling due to right iliac vein stenosis. No mass was identified around the stenotic site, and the vessel wall had not become thickened. Self-expandable stents were positioned at the stenotic site. About two years later, chest CT revealed lung nodules. Pathology showed sarcoma. A mass that was considered to be the primary lesion was found around the stent in the right iliac vein. Although sarcoma of the iliac vein is very rare, it should be considered in the differential diagnosis of iliac vein stenosis, even if there are no suspicious findings from image studies.

Pramipexole-related chronic lower limb oedema in a patient with Parkinson's disease.

Abstract


Pramipexole is a non-ergot dopamine agonist that is used frequently as a single therapy or in combination for the management of Parkinson's disease. Common side effects are daytime drowsiness, hypotension, hallucinations and compulsive behaviour. We describe a patient who developed severe chronic and extensive lymphoedema after pramipexole was introduced and that resolved after its cessation.
